PREOPERATION PROCEDURES
CHECK POWER SOURCE
1. Each sinker drill has been assembled before
leaving the factory, so it is necessary to check
whether there is any damage caused in the
shipping process or whether there is debris
2. entrained in the assembly when the first use
3. Using a calibrated flow meter and pressure gauge,
make sure the hydraulic power source develops a
flow of 20 Ipm at 155 bar.
4. Make certain that the power source is equipped with
a relief valve set to open at 2100-2250 psi/145-155
bar maximum.
5. Make certain that the power source return pressure

CONNECT HOSES
1. Wipe all hose couplers with a clean lint free cloth
before making connections.
2. Connect the hoses from the hydraulic power source
to the couplers on the sinker drill.
3. Observe the arrow on the couplers to ensure the
flow is in the proper direction.

COLD WEATHER OPERATION
If the tool is to be used during cold weather, preheat the
hydraulic fluid at low engine speed. When using the normally
recommended fluids, fluid temperature should be at or above
50 °F/10 °C (400 ssu/82 centistokes) before use.
Drill deep holes for operation
1. When the depth of the drilling hole is more than 1
meter, an external air source is required for
operation. An external air source pipe is inserted at the
lower inlet hole..
NOTE:
If uncoupled hoses are left in the sun, pressure in-
crease inside the hoses might make them difficult to
connect. Whenever possible, connect the free ends
of the hoses together.
